  • Publication number: 20240094464
    Abstract: A semiconductor-on-insulator (SOI) structure and a method for forming the SOI structure. The method includes forming a first dielectric layer on a first semiconductor layer. A second semiconductor layer is formed over an etch stop layer. A cleaning solution is provided to a first surface of the first dielectric layer. The first dielectric layer is bonded under the second semiconductor layer in an environment having a substantially low pressure. An index guiding layer may be formed over the second semiconductor layer. A third semiconductor layer is formed over the second semiconductor layer. A distance between a top of the third semiconductor layer and a bottom of the second semiconductor layer varies between a maximum distance and a minimum distance. A planarization process is performed on the third semiconductor layer to reduce the maximum distance.

  • Patent number: 8092050
    Abstract: A fluid-convection heat dissipation device includes at least one heat dissipation module, at least two baffles, and a heat dissipation fluid. The heat dissipation module forms at least one internal receiving space and has an outside surface to which at least one light emission element is attached. The baffles are arranged in the receiving space to divide the receiving space into a plurality of convection channels that are in fluid communication with each other. The heat dissipation fluid is received in the receiving space as a convection medium displaceable in a circulating path along the plurality of convection channels.

  • Patent number: 7677748
    Abstract: Disclosed is a light guide device for a water spraying device. The light guide device includes a light guide block that is a light-transmitting block having a refractive index greater than one. The light guide block has a circumferential face in which a plurality of mounting holes is defined for receiving and retaining light-emitting elements. A plurality of through holes is defined through the light guide blocks and extends in a direction substantially perpendicular to the mounting holes. Each through hole has a roughened inside surface. The through holes are in fluid communication with water discharge holes of the water spraying device so that water jets supplied from the water spraying device can flow through the through holes for discharging. The light-emitting elements emit light rays that transmit through the light guide block and get into the through holes and the water jets. The rays are subject to reflection inside the water jets to provide lighting or luminous effect to the water jets.

  • Patent number: 5121098
    Abstract: A multi-function car door closure warning sensor includes a main module secured to a car door adjacent to an edge thereof, and an auxiliary module secured to the car body and adjacent with the main module, when the car door is in a closed position. A battery, a first soft magnetic pole piece with an attached normally closed magnetic switch, a buzzer, two sets of L.E.D.'s, and an L.E.D. control circuit are disposed within the main module. A permanent magnet with an atached second soft magnetic pole piece are disposed within the auxiliary module. Whereby, when the door is properly closed, the first and second soft magnetic pole pieces are aligned and separated by a small gap. The permanent magnet induces a magnetic field in the first pole piece which causes the magnetic switch to open.   • Patent number: 5083249
    Abstract: A light marker for fishing rod comprises a main body which has a plurality of female threads in its inner periphery, a battery unit which has two cells in parallel and a plurality of male threads at the lower outer periphery of the battery unit, a light-emitting diode which has a ring-shaped upper conductor and a rod-shaped lower conductor, a cupped pusher which has a lower protrusion and an upper protrusion, and a holder which has a vertical through hole and a transverse taper hole. The battery unit is disposed in the upper center of the main body. The light-emitting diode is disposed at the front portion of the main body. The cupped pusher is disposed below the battery unit. The holder is disposed beneath the main body.
